Here is the comprehensive history of the Sad Satan mystery, the truth behind the "G5.jpg" file, and how the internet finally unmasked its creator. The Origins of Sad Satan

Originally emerging in 2015 via the YouTube channel Obscure Horror Corner , the game became an internet urban legend due to its purported origins in the "Deep Web" and its disturbing audio-visual nature.

The gameplay featured a slow-walking character traversing negative-exposure mazes. The audio design consisted of slowed-down, reversed tracks—including Led Zeppelin's "Stairway to Heaven"—layered with audio clips of infamous figures. sad satan g5jpg verified

The word in the search phrase is the most important part. While countless shock images float around the internet, G5.jpg was actually identified by investigators and linked to a real-world criminal case.

Evidence strongly indicates that the owner of created the initial "safe" version themselves to orchestrate a viral marketing hoax for channel views. The second, highly toxic version containing the malicious files and the g5.jpg assets was likely compiled by a malicious third party on 4chan who hijacked the hype to distribute malware and illegal media under the original "ZK" moniker.
